First off...Call George and have him put two cables on your order...
Put the spare one in the trunk...you will thank me someday within the next 5 years. Remove drivers side carpet. Remove plywood pedal board..it does come out, a few allen head bolts and it really does come out without breaking it....its just a bit of an odd puzzle... If you have a center console...remove it and put it on the passenger floor. Remove the cable end that attaches to the gas pedal on the pedal cluster. Pull out the broken end via the front. Disconnect the cable at the throttle body and feed it under the car. Pull it out of the tube. Slide new one in (greased and lubed) Hook it all back up. |
